Saha in line for a move to United
LONDON, England -- Fulham have said they have " agreed in principle" to the transfer of their in-form French striker Louis Saha to English champions Manchester United.
On their official website, they said: "Fulham Football Club can confirm that it has reached an agreement in principle with Manchester United for the transfer of the registration of Louis Saha, subject to a number of conditions.
"Fulham FC expects these conditions to be resolved within the next week."
Saha, 25, has scored 15 goals for Fulham this season, playing a major part in their climb to the top six of the Premiership, and was recently linked with a move to the club's arch London rivals Chelsea.
He has been unsettled since United's interest became public and has made it clear he wants to leave for a bigger club in the hope of boosting his prospects of making France's Euro 2004 squad.
